What is the tunnel that lava travels to reach the top of the volcano called?

The tunnel through which lava travels to reach the surface of a volcano is called a volcanic conduit. It is a passage that connects the magma chamber below the volcano to the vent at the surface. The lava moves through this conduit under pressure before erupting onto the surface.


Why would lava flow faster through a lava tube than it would above ground?

The solidified lava forming the walls of the lava tube will act to insulate the molten lava. It will therefore cool more slowly than lava at the surface and so will have a lower viscosity (it will be more runny) and so will flow faster than lava at the surface.


What is the difference between lava flow lava fountains and lava tubes?

A lava flow is basically a stream of lava on the surface. A lava tube is an underground cave through which lava flows downhill. A lava fountain is lava shooting into the air out of a volcano in much the same manner as a water fountain.


What carves into a tube-shaped structure as magma rises?

As magma rises through the Earth's crust, it can carve into a tube-shaped structure known as a lava tube. This occurs when the outer surface of the flowing lava cools and solidifies while the molten lava continues to flow beneath it, creating a hollow channel. Over time, as the eruption ceases and the lava drains away, these tubes can remain as natural conduits. Lava tubes are often found in volcanic regions and can vary in size and complexity.

What is a lava tube cave?

A lava tube cave is a natural tunnel formed by the flow of lava, creating a channel for molten lava to move through during a volcanic eruption. When the lava flow stops, the tube can cool, leaving behind a cave-like structure with unique geological features.
